Badges
Certifications
Work Experience
Programmer Analyst
Cognizant Technology Solutions•  October 2021 - Present
Project Details:- HBase to Snowflake Migration My Role and Responsibilities:- I was part of the data team for this project. #Worked on the whole data migration pipeline. #Handled SIT, UAT, and Prod Data migration cycles multiple times. #Came up with solutions when we found errors in data load-scripts. (Problem-Solving) The tools and technology I used for this project 1. Apache Oozie:- It's a workflow scheduler system that allows us to perform all migrations in one go. Creating Oozie jobs and testing them for errors was my responsibility. In the case of a successful Oozie job execution, data is successfully migrated from source to target. 2. Snowflake:- I used to prepare data loading queries that can handle exceptions. Also, I have created SPs (Stored Procedures) for data loading scripts for automation. 3. Jupiter Validation Tool:- Once I had created all the scripts, I used the Jupiter validation tool to make sure that data records matched in all the 3 layers. 4. Spark:- Spark use in this project is very minimal. I have gone through the Spark code. Our client developed it.
Education
Graphic Era Hill University
Computer Science, B.Tech•  2017 - 2021
Links
Skills
sourabh955715111 has not updated skills details yet.